Duncan Ferguson is vice president responsible for the commercial and industrial printing businesses for Epson in Europe. Having worked previously for both Shell and Kodak, Duncan joined Epson in 2003, and had a key role in establishing Epson’s UltraChrome ink family and Epson’s Precision Core micro-piezo printheads as market leading technologies. Duncan has held various senior management roles at Epson covering professional printing, labels, signage, textiles and robotics. He has a strong interest in “useful technology”, always keen to understand how Epson can benefit individual companies as well as wider society. Duncan has a degree in Chemistry from the University of Durham. He is married with two children, is a keen cricketer, and recently took up cycling during the Covid crisis.
